In Fourier transform spectroscopy, the use of birefringent materials allows to realize compact spectrometers without moving parts. Nevertheless, to reconstruct an accurate spectrum, one must take into account two important characteristics. First of all, one must consider the wavelength dependence on the refractive indices that produces a distortion of the spectrum abscise axis. A calibration procedure is proposed in this paper, rectifying this point. Then, one must consider the nonlinear dependence on the optical path difference with the position on the CCD sensor that prohibits the direct computation of the spectrum. A pre-processing method is suggested in order to offset this non-linearity. Some experimental results support our matter
